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Show properties from the person's initial event in their person properties #2866

Closed
Twixes opened this issue Jan 6, 2021 · 6 comments
Closed
Labels
enhancement New feature or request good first issue Good for newcomers

Comments

@Twixes
Copy link
Member

Twixes commented Jan 6, 2021

Is your feature request related to a problem?

The circumstances of how the user first got to your app/website are potentially valuable information (e.g. date of first event, IP address, location), but currently require searching through events. This should be visible right away on the person's page. Currently posthog-js sets $initial_referrer and $initial_referring_domain from the client, but we could do more, also server-side.

Describe the solution you'd like

Select properties from the person's initial event should be added to them as person properties, so that they're readily accessible and visible on the person's page.

Inspiration from Heap:

Screen Shot 2021-01-06 at 10 19 58

Additional context

Requested by a user, who are ditching Heap due to cost and found this to be a useful feature.

Thank you for your feature request – we love each and every one!

@Twixes Twixes added enhancement New feature or request good first issue Good for newcomers labels Jan 6, 2021
@paolodamico
Copy link
Contributor

paolodamico commented Jan 15, 2021

Didn't see this before, definitely +1

@paolodamico
Copy link
Contributor

For reference, attaching a screenshot from what another product (Heap I believe) does to support this, gracefully donated by a user.

image

@akbansa
Copy link
Contributor

akbansa commented Feb 23, 2021

This would be super helpful!

@mariusandra
Copy link
Collaborator

This has (almost) landed! It will work only when you're using ingestion via plugin server: PostHog/plugin-server#214 ... and once the 0.11.0 version is added to this repo (autobump failed due to some CI bug, will be fixed soon).

Still to do: the $ properties could get a 🦔 and some text cleanup:
image

@timgl
Copy link
Collaborator

timgl commented Feb 26, 2021

Yep I'll pick that up next!

@Twixes
Copy link
Member Author

Twixes commented Jan 12, 2022

All this works now.

@Twixes Twixes closed this as completed Jan 12,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request good first issue Good for newcomers
Projects
None yet
Development

No branches or pull requests

5 participants